BabyLM Evaluation 2026

BabyLM Challenge

This repository contains the setup for evaluation for BabyLM 2026. We provide separate evaluation for the Strict (+Strict-Small) track, and the Multilingual track. See the two track directories for more specific information on evaluation for these two tracks.

Submitting to the leaderboard

The two tracks use different submission formats:

Strict and Strict-small tracks

Upload a predictions file produced by the BabyLM evaluation pipeline. After running both zero-shot and fine-tuning evaluation on your final model, create the submission file with:

cd strict
bash scripts/collate_preds.sh NAME_OF_YOUR_MODEL BACKEND SUBMISSION_TRACK

Scores are computed server-side against the held-out targets, so you only upload predictions. Add the --fast flag to also include checkpoint evaluation results, which is required for a full BabyLM Challenge submission.

Multilingual track

Upload a pre-computed scores file. Run zero-shot and fine-tuning evaluation first, then collate the results into a single submission file:

cd multilingual
bash scripts/zeroshot_model.sh --model_name YOUR_MODEL --langs "eng nld zho"
bash scripts/finetune_model.sh --model_name YOUR_MODEL --langs "eng nld zho"

# Collate into a single submission file
python scripts/collate_results.py --model_name YOUR_MODEL

Note

Incomplete evaluation is allowed for both tracks: you can submit results covering only the languages or tasks your model was trained on. Missing tasks are set to 0 and are taken into account when computing the average score.

Important

Make sure your model is publicly available on HuggingFace before submitting.

Baselines

We train GPT-2 baseline models on the datasets. We provide monolingual models, as well as bi- and trilingual models, trained on equal language splits. The models are available on HuggingFace here.

Following BabyBabelLM, we divide evaluation for the multilingual models up in zero-shot and fine-tuning evaluation. Zero-shot evaluation for the multilingual track is done through lm-eval. Fine-tuning is adapted from a script of previous BabyLM editions.
